Depending on the direction of the 5 N and 12 N forces the magnitude of the sum could be as big as 17 N obtained when the two forces are in the same direction and as small as 7 N obtained when the two forces are in opposite directions. When two forces act on a point particle the resulting force the resultant also called the net force can be determined by following the parallelogram rule of vector addition.
